Phase 2

Pre-Design & Feasibility

Before committing to full design, we conduct a thorough feasibility assessment: site analysis, zoning review, preliminary budget range, and project scope definition. This phase ensures that what you want to build is actually achievable on your lot, within your budget, and within local code requirements.

Site Analysis Topography, drainage, setbacks, utilities, and access review
Budget Framework We establish realistic cost ranges before design begins
Zoning & Code Review of local ordinances, HOA rules, and permitting requirements
Duration 1–3 weeks

Phase 4

Construction Documents & Permitting

Once the design is finalized, our team produces detailed construction documents and submits for all necessary permits. This phase includes structural engineering, MEP (mechanical, electrical, plumbing) coordination, and a refined, fixed-price proposal for construction.

Documents Full construction drawings, specifications, and engineering plans
Permitting We manage the entire permit application and approval process
Fixed-Price Proposal A detailed, itemized construction contract with no hidden costs
Duration 4–8 weeks (permitting timelines vary by jurisdiction)

How long does a custom home build take in the Triangle? +
From initial design through move-in, a custom new home in the Cary/Triangle area typically takes 12–18 months. Simpler projects may come in shorter; larger or more complex homes may take longer. We'll provide a detailed schedule based on your specific project during the proposal phase.
What does a design-build project cost? +
In the Greater Triangle market, custom new home construction typically ranges from $190–$400+ per square foot depending on quality tier, finishes, and site conditions. Renovations and additions vary more widely. Use our Project Estimator for a ballpark, and we'll provide a detailed proposal after your consultation.
Do I need to own land before starting? +
Not necessarily. We work with many clients who are still in the lot-finding stage. We can advise on lot suitability, evaluating soil, drainage, topography, and local zoning, before you commit to a purchase. We also maintain relationships with local real estate professionals who specialize in lot acquisition.
How do change orders work? +
Change orders are formal written amendments to the construction contract. Before any change is made, we provide you with a written description of the change, the cost impact, and the schedule impact. You approve before we proceed. We work hard to front-load decisions in the design phase to minimize mid-build changes.
Can I live in my home during a renovation? +
It depends on the scope. For whole-home renovations, temporary relocation is usually the most comfortable option. For phased renovations or additions, we work to contain the construction zone and minimize disruption so you can remain in your home throughout much of the build. We'll discuss the best approach during planning.
What warranties do you provide? +
We provide a comprehensive 1-year builder's warranty covering workmanship and materials, plus pass-through warranties on all manufacturer-warranted products (appliances, HVAC systems, windows, etc.). We also conduct 30-day and 11-month follow-up inspections to address any emerging items before the warranty expires.
